    Friday, October 11

    Four Peaks Brewing Oktoberfest

    When: Friday - Sunday
    Where: Tempe Town Lake
    Cost: Admission is $25 at the gate | Free Admission Sunday | 20 and Under Free Admission

    Four Peaks Brewing Co. invites you to the 2024 Oktoberfest! A weekend full of entertainment for all ages, German food & beers and plenty of Oom Pah Pah! This event is a long-standing Tempe tradition celebrating more than 50 years and benefitting the work of Tempe Sister Cities.

    DTPHX Urban Ale Trail

    When: 1 p.m. - 5 p.m.
    Where: Downtown Phoenix
    Cost: Free self-guided tour

    Rock n' Hop your way through Downtown Phoenix, the urban foodie paradise that also boasts one of the most extensive and diverse craft beer scenes in Arizona. Don't miss your opportunity to taste (and sip) your way through some of the state's best bars and restaurants. This year, live music will be staged throughout the trail, so you can enjoy entertainment while experiencing the event. Each location will offer three 4-oz beer and snack pairings for $5 each. If you can't pick just one, try all three for $15. Registration is not necessary, and the Trail can be done in any order.
